A generator set is a complete set of equipment that converts other forms of energy into electrical energy. Its core is the prime mover (such as a diesel engine) that drives the rotation of the generator rotor, using the principle of electromagnetic induction so that the rotating magnetic field cuts through the stator windings, thereby generating electrical energy.

IV. Considerations for Choosing a Generator Set
1. Power Calculation: Accurately calculate the total operating power of all electrical equipment, and specifically account for the starting peak power of devices such as motors. When selecting the rated power of the generator set, a safety margin of 20%–30% should be reserved on this basis.
2. Physical Conditions: Consider the installation site's altitude, temperature, and humidity. High altitude and high temperature can cause a decrease in engine power, so a model with higher power should be selected.
3. Noise: In residential areas and similar locations, a silent-type generator set should be chosen. Emissions: Must comply with local environmental regulations.
4. Type of Generator Set: Diesel generators, gasoline generators, natural gas generators, etc. Users should select according to specific operational needs.
5. Performance and Brand: Choose brands with mature technology and stable voltage and frequency. Understand the difference between KVA (apparent power) and KW (active power).
6. Full Life Cycle Cost: In addition to the purchase price, focus on long-term operational costs such as fuel consumption, maintenance, and upkeep.
7. After-Sales Service: Reliable technical support and parts supply are key guarantees for long-term stable operation.
V. Q&A on Generator Set Knowledge
1. How to calculate the required power of a generator set?
First, calculate the total operating power of all electrical equipment, paying special attention to the starting peak power of devices such as motors. The rated power of the generator set should be 20%-30% higher than the total power as a safety margin.
2. Why must the generator room be kept clean?
Because if the diesel engine intakes dirty air, it will lead to a power drop; if the generator intakes sand or other impurities, it can damage the insulation between the stator and rotor, and in severe cases, may cause winding burnout.
3. What parameters should be monitored during daily inspections of the generator set?
You should monitor whether the voltage, current, and frequency are within the rated range; check the lubrication oil pressure and coolant temperature; observe exhaust color; listen for any abnormal noises and vibrations; check for oil leaks, water leaks, or electrical leakage.
VI. Application Scenarios of Generator Sets
Generator sets are mainly used in situations where utility power is unavailable or emergency backup power is needed.
1. Primary Power Source: Used as the main power supply in remote areas, mines, oil fields, and other places without a stable power grid or requiring independent power supply.
2. Emergency Backup Power: Generator sets provide power assurance for critical locations such as data centers, hospitals, financial institutions, communication base stations, high-rise buildings, and residential area fire protection systems.
3. Mobile or Temporary Power: Generator sets are used for road construction, bridge building, emergency rescue, and other outdoor or temporary work sites.
